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7252878276 20 683921887 5203026
406583 691082200
406583 691082200
646 603043 1694743 06 0611074014
All about undefined
Interested in learning more?
406583 691082200
646 603043 1694743 06 0611074014
See more
01152429052 1743913696
26120855 998496 80919
See more
245 7368145
243295239 36159 15887
See more